The First Descendant has some pretty awesome moments, from fighting waves of enemies and ripping off Colossus parts to awesome personal missions. However, expecting everything to be great is unrealistic, and some flops are bound to happen. Like the infamous “super-mario-jump” missions for example, or, the subject of today’s article, the drone escort missions.
Escort missions are arguably the most annoying mission type in all multiplayer games, and the situation is not different in TFD. Thankfully, there aren’t many of them, but the problem arises when a Descendant or a Weapon part that you need is only obtainable from one of those (like Freyna Stabilizer). The missions are already a slog, but one mechanic is making stuff way more annoying than it should be.
The Shield Recharge Mechanic Needs To Go
When doing the Drone Escort missions, you have to follow a drone around, and “power it up” using your own Shields. That means you have to be both nearby and have some Shields, or it will not move (or crawl, to be more specific) at all.
One player, named theoutsider95 on Reddit, started a discussion saying that the Shield Recharge requirement makes these already irritating missions a pain to deal with. “Escort missions are boring, but then here you need shields to move the drone. Your shields get removed by one or 2 shots by the enemy, and you need to wait a while for it to Regen (even if you have equipped some shield Regen).”
Or Better Yet, Redesign the Escort Missions
The majority of players actually call for a redesign of these missions or outright removal. To be completely honest, they are not Nexon’s best work. You have to escort a slow-moving drone, power it up with Shields, and fight off enemy waves that are more annoying than challenging. The drone has a lot of ground to cover, making this a pretty “brainless” operation, with little to no engagement required.
As perfectly summed up by energizernutter: “Those missions make void shard farming look fun.” User mr-_-tete said: “They need to be redesigned to not need Doing. I don’t think anyone in this game likes doing these missions.” and xBlack_Heartx added: “I’d prefer if they just removed them from the game entirely and replaced them with something far more interesting.”
While outright removal of these missions would be the best, we understand that it requires a lot of work. The OP added: “…removing a mission and adding a new one takes resources. So, an easy “fix” would [be] removing the shield requirement.” But some tweaking would only benefit the game. For example, making the drone move faster if your Descendant level is higher than the Mission level would make it feel a bit less like a chore. We hope Nexon realizes this and makes some improvements, if not in Season 1, then somewhere in the near future.
